Here we have shared the files to download and install Stock Firmware on Turewell T95 S1 TV Box which is powered by the Amlogic S905W processor. Turewell T95 S1 TV Box comes packed with Android 7.1 Nougat firmware with 2GB RAM and 16GB ROM. If you are looking for Turewell T95 S1 TV Box Stock Firmware, then you are in the right place.

Firmware Details:

Package Name: Turewell T95 S1 Firmware Package
Device Model: Turewell T95 S1 TV Box
File Size: 628 MB
Processor: Amlogic S905W CPU
Android OS: 7.1 Nougat

Prerequisites

  • Please note that this guide will work only with the Turewell T95 S1 TV Box.
  • You should have a formatted SD Card for this guide.
  • Download Amlogic Burn Card Maker v2.0.2
  • Download Amlogic USB Burning Tool v2.1.6
